Inauguration programme of “Bhasha Gaurab Saptah” is held on 4/11/24 at Arya Vidyapeeth College. This programme is inaugurated by Dr. Pradip Kumar Bhattacharyya, Principal of the College.
Students from various departments have recited Assamese poetry from charyapada till date. A good number of teachers and students were present in the programme. Besides this, family member of Sahitya Akademy awardee poet Nalinidhar Bhattacharyya (Smt. Minu Bhattacharya, daughter) were also present in the function. Smt. Minu Bhattacharya donated two nos of almira to the Assamese dept. in the memory of her father Nalinidhar Bhattacharya. The meeting is hosted by Dr. Gitanjali Hazarika, HoD dept. of Assamese.
On the second day of the celebration of Bhasha Gaurab Saptah, a lecture is delivered by Lierateur Ratneswar Basumatary on Asamiya aru Boro Bhasha: uttaranar parasparik sahayogita. Total 140 nos of people gathered in the meeting and a lively interaction was held . As today is the thirteenth death anniversary of Sudhakantha Dr. Bhupen Hazarika the meeting also offered respect to the icon and Nishangi Talukdar a student of the college cum all india radio artist performed a Bhupendra sangit. The host of the programme was Dr. Gitanjali Hazarika.
on the 3 rd day of “Bhasha Gaurab Saptah” (6th november 2024) students engaged in reading some of the selected Assamese short stories from beginning till date. They have also taken the time to wrote letters of gratitude to the honourable prime minister of India Mr. Narendra Modi, expressing their appreciation for granting classical status to the Assamese language.Altogether 156 people were present in the meeting. The meeting is host by Dr. Gitanjali Hazarika. Dr. Pranita Barman, Dr. Ruli Barthakur, Lakhyana Dutta, Dr. Manashi Devi, Priyanka kashyap and other faculty members were present in the programme and guide the students for writing letters to honourable prime minister.
On 7th November 2024, the students of Arya vidyapeeth College wrote in social media on the importance of Assamese and other local languages of Assam to celebrate “Bhasha Gaurab Saptah”.
On 8th November, Arya vidyapeeth college (autonomous) community performed Rupkonwar Jyotiprashad Agarwala’s famous dramma “Sonit kuwari” to celebrate “Bhaxa Gaurav Xaptah”. 200 people ( including faculty membets )were present in the programme. The host of the programme was Dr. Gitanjali Hazarika.
On last day, a day long programme is arranged. First, a speech competition is held among students on the subject “o mor suria maat”.The competition is judged by Dr. Ruli Borthakur, Dept. Of Zoology and Dr Chanchal Boruah, Dept. Of Mathematics. Mr. Madhurya Hazarika, a 3rd sem student received the first prize.
In the second part of the programme, Professor Lilawati Saikia Bora, a writer cum sharp critic and Rtd. Professor and HoD of Gauhati University graced the event with a thoughtful talk on “Assamese as a Dhrupadi language and the liabilities of Asamiya”. In valedictory session a cultural event is held. Dr. Pranita Barman, Lakhyana Dutta, Priyanka Kashyap, Dr. Manashi Devi have arranged the cultural event successfully. The participants were prepared well by Ms. Lakhyana Dutta, Assistant professor dept. Of Assamese. The host of the entire programme was Dr. Gitanjali Hazarika, HoD. Dept. Of Assamese.
